Product description
Tomato 'Honeycomb' is an exceptional F1 hybrid cherry tomato, celebrated for its unique colour and intensely sweet flavour. This productive cordon variety grows as a tall vine, yielding long, cascading trusses of beautiful, golden-orange fruits. The tomatoes have a delicious honey-like sweetness and a crisp texture, making this award-winning variety a superb choice for a greenhouse or warm, sheltered spot for a gourmet harvest.
Sow 'Honeycomb' seeds in pots or trays of compost under cover, keeping them in a warm place at around 20-22C for reliable germination. When the seedlings have developed their first true leaves, carefully prick them out into individual pots and grow them on in bright, frost-free conditions. Gradually acclimatise the young plants to outdoor conditions before moving them to their final growing position after all risk of hard frost has passed.
Choose a spot in full sun with rich, fertile, and well-draining soil. As a highly productive cordon variety, it is essential to provide sturdy support, such as a tall cane or string, for the vine to be tied to as it grows. Space plants about 45-60cm apart. Water consistently and feed regularly with a high-potash fertiliser once the first fruits begin to form. To direct energy into fruiting, regularly pinch out the side shoots that appear between the main stem and leaf branches.
